ABC7 New York on MSN
Travel chaos continues at airports across US, Tri-State area as spring break begins
Over 121 million Americans are expected to fly over the next couple of weeks as spring break begins for many students and ...
The storm has started to wrap up in New York City, New Jersey and beyond, with impressive snow totals left in its wake.
Some results have been hidden because they may be inaccessible to you
Show inaccessible results